Output 537629f1c85197a8abdee4b8500945e4da57333374fa63dd376bee87127ac924:8

value
511129
script pubkey
OP_0 OP_PUSHBYTES_20 63f354e39108af0b598c4d908a3e38a50ec6d5ca
address
bc1qv0e4fcu3pzhskkvvfkgg503c558vd4w24kcem6
transaction
537629f1c85197a8abdee4b8500945e4da57333374fa63dd376bee87127ac924